标题:再问一下关于数据库的数据修改的
只看楼主
hxfly
Rank: 5Rank: 5
等 级:贵宾
威 望:17
帖 子:5807
专家分:108
注 册:2005-4-7
得分:0 
请问楼上的大哥确定是set rs=conn.Execute(sql)这句没错吗?


没有错
是你的 rs.execute 错了
没有这个用法
可以conn.execute(sql)

2005-04-26 17:04
3201
Rank: 1
等 级:新手上路
帖 子:174
专家分:0
注 册:2005-4-12
得分:0 
请问一下conn代表的是什么呢?

 是对象名吗?

 还是自定义的 ?

努力中的菜鸟,请多支持············ 蠢问题多,请多见谅···········o_0
2005-04-26 17:36
hxfly
Rank: 5Rank: 5
等 级:贵宾
威 望:17
帖 子:5807
专家分:108
注 册:2005-4-7
得分:0 
数据库连接文件

2005-04-26 17:42
3201
Rank: 1
等 级:新手上路
帖 子:174
专家分:0
注 册:2005-4-12
得分:0 
指的是set conn=server.createobject("ADODB.Connection") 这一句定义的吗 ?

 还是不用定义直接就可以用了 ?

努力中的菜鸟,请多支持············ 蠢问题多,请多见谅···········o_0
2005-04-26 18:01
yms123
Rank: 16Rank: 16Rank: 16Rank: 16
等 级:版主
威 望:209
帖 子:12488
专家分:19042
注 册:2004-7-17
得分:0 
以下是引用3201在2005-4-26 18:01:05的发言: 指的是set conn=server.createobject("ADODB.Connection") 这一句定义的吗 ? 还是不用定义直接就可以用了 ?
set conn=server.createobject("ADODB.Connection") conn是服务器端的组件,必须先用Server.CreateObject来创建对象。 当然不加强制变量声明,是可以直接set conn=server.createobject("ADODB.Connection") 这么用的,但是建议是变量都要定义。这是编程习惯问题,就跟吃饭睡觉得有好的习惯一样。编程也得要有好的习惯,定义变量一是习惯问题。二是便于错误的查找,可以很快找到错误。
2005-04-26 21:27
3201
Rank: 1
等 级:新手上路
帖 子:174
专家分:0
注 册:2005-4-12
得分:0 
谢谢各位大侠的解答

努力中的菜鸟,请多支持············ 蠢问题多,请多见谅···········o_0
2005-04-27 10:25
hxfly
Rank: 5Rank: 5
等 级:贵宾
威 望:17
帖 子:5807
专家分:108
注 册:2005-4-7
得分:0 
真不容易啊
你最终还是明白了

2005-04-27 10:32
3201
Rank: 1
等 级:新手上路
帖 子:174
专家分:0
注 册:2005-4-12
得分:0 
呵呵 不好意思啊

 我有点钻牛角尖了

 因为我想知道一下能不能不通过connection 方法  用recordset 在opne之后的程序中是不是也能直接用SQL语句操作数据(不使用addnew等的方法)

努力中的菜鸟,请多支持············ 蠢问题多,请多见谅···········o_0
2005-04-27 10:39



参与讨论请移步原网站贴子:https://bbs.bccn.net/thread-16579-1-1.html




关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.360262 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ved